What is a photosynthesis​

Social Studies
2 answers:
Mashutka [201]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Photosynthesis is the process in which plants use water, carbon dioxide and light to produce oxygen and glucose.

______________ are city courts that hear violations of city ordinances. A. County courts b. Municipal courts c. District courts
Zanzabum

Answer:

b. Municipal courts

Explanation:

**Municipal courts, or city courts, deal with violations of city ordinances committed within city limits.

**Cases usually involve traffic and other minor offenses.

**A person charged with an offense in municipal court may be represented by a lawyer.

**The judge hears cases without a jury.

** Anyone convicted in municipal court may appeal to the district court of the county where the municipal court is located.

Write a paragraph that compares and contrasts how wealthy people might have lived in ancient Rome with how poor people and slave
Lostsunrise [7]

Answer:

For wealthy Romans, life was good. They lived in beautiful houses – often on the hills outside Rome, away from the noise and the smell. They enjoyed an extravagant lifestyle with luxurious furnishings, surrounded by servants and slaves to cater to their every desire. Many would hold exclusive dinner parties and serve their guests the exotic dishes of the day.

and for the poor ,

Poorer Romans, however, could only dream of such a life. Sweating it out in the city, they lived in shabby, squalid houses that could collapse or burn at any moment. If times were hard, they might abandon newborn babies to the streets, hoping that someone else would take them in as a servant or slave. Poor in wealth but strong in numbers, they were the Roman mob, who relaxed in front of the popular entertainment of the time – chariot races between opposing teams, or gladiators fighting for their life, fame and fortune.

Although their lives may have been different, they did have some things in common. In any Roman family life, the head of the household was a man. Although his wife looked after the household, he controlled it. He alone could own property. Only he decided the fate of his children and who they would marry.
